An electrostatic air cleaner is a device that removes polluting particulates, thus
purifying air. As an example, contaminated air carrying a particulate, with a mass
of 3.15 ´ 10-9 kg, will first pass through a charging grid, removing an electron and
charging the particulate with a +1 charge. These positive particulates are then
removed by being attracted to the negative grid and remaining on the grid as the
rest of the clean air passes through.
